Description

This building is a former miller's cottage with a granary above, located approximately 30 yards northeast of Holburn Mill. It dates from the early 19th century and is constructed of ashlar with a Welsh slate roof. The structure is two storeys high and features three bays, along with a single-storey, lean-to extension on the left side.

On the ground floor, the cottage has a central boarded door with an overlight and windows on either side. The granary on the first floor includes small louvred openings. The roof is gabled with flat coping and has end stacks, one of which is partly demolished. Access to the granary is provided by external stone steps at the rear.
